Claims
- 1. An engine comprising:a cylinder; a piston slidably received in the cylinder and shiftable in opposite first and second directions; a first power source operable to alternately shift the piston in the first and second directions, said first power source including a combustible organic fuel and means for combusting the organic fuel inside the cylinder; and a second power source operable to alternately shift the piston in the first and second directions, said second power source including a noncombustible inorganic material and means for expanding the material inside the cylinder, said cylinder including a cylinder head and a cylinder foot spaced from the cylinder head, each being operable to generally seal the cylinder, said cylinder presenting internal spaced apart first and second chambers defined between the cylinder head and foot, said piston including a piston head, said piston shiftable between a first position wherein the piston head is located in the first chamber and a second position wherein the piston head is located in the second chamber, said first power source including a first injector operable to inject said combustible organic fuel into said first chamber, said first power source being operable to shift the piston from the first position to the second position.
- 2. The engine as claimed in claim 1,said cylinder power source including a second injector operable to injector said noncombustible inorganic material into said second chamber, said second power source being operable to shift the piston from the second position to the first position.
- 3. The engine as claimed in claim 1, said noncombustible inorganic material being water.
- 4. The engine as claimed in claim 3,said second power source including an injector operable to inject ssaid water into said first chamber, said means for expanding the water inside the cylinder including heating the first chamber by said combusting the organic fuel inside the cylinder and injecting said water into the heated first chamber to thereby convert said water into steam.
- 5. The engine as claimed in claim 1;a storage tank in fluid communication with the cylinder and being operable to store the inorganic material for delivery to the cylinder; and an insulated box incasing the cylinder, the piston, and the storage tank, said box being formed in major portion of resin.
- 6. The engine as claimed in claim 5, said box encasing substantially the intire engine.
- 7. The engine as claimed in claim 1; anda rotatable crankshaft, said piston including a piston rod extending at least partially through said cylinder foot and being in driving communication with said crankshaft.
- 8. The engine as claimed in claim 7; andan oil gallery operable to supply a metered amount of oil to said crankshaft for each rotation thereof, least a portion of said gallery being disposed within said piston and at least an additional portion of said gallery being disposed within said cylinder.
- 9. The engine as claimed in claim 7; andat least a pair of piston rod rings received between the cylinder foot and the piston rod and being operable to create a seal therebetween, said rings each being generally semicircular in configuration.
